Yes it’s real, but it’s not worth that much. If the date isn’t there it’s usually just 5 bucks. If the date is there it depends on the % offset it is. Generally it has to be more than 5% off to be worth anything over face. 5-80% is the sweet spot.
Normally after 80% it’s too offset to have the date still, but the money shot is 85-90 with the date and in uncirculated condition. If you could imagine being that offset and still with the date is fairly difficult to pull off, so they are more rare. But even then they are common enough to only be worth 30-40 dollars in that exceptional state.
